SubjectRe: [PATCH v6 04/51] mm: Move PageDoubleMap bit
Date
On 10 Jun 2020, at 16:12, Matthew Wilcox wrote:

> From: "Matthew Wilcox (Oracle)" <willy@infradead.org>
>
> PG_private_2 is defined as being PF_ANY (applicable to tail pages
> as well as regular & head pages). That means that the first tail
> page of a double-map page will appear to have Private2 set. Use the
> Workingset bit instead which is defined as PF_HEAD so any attempt to
> access the Workingset bit on a tail page will redirect to the head page's
> Workingset bit.
